如何在云主机上部署网站
- 行业动态
- 2024-05-17
- 2
在云主机上部署网站是一个涉及多个步骤的过程,以下是一个详细的指南:
1. 购买云主机服务
你需要选择一个云主机服务提供商,如阿里云、腾讯云、华为云等,然后购买相应的云主机服务。
2. 登录云主机
使用SSH客户端(如PuTTY)登录到你的云主机,你将需要云主机的IP地址、用户名和密码。
3. 安装Web服务器
大多数网站都运行在Web服务器上,例如Apache或Nginx,你可以使用包管理器(如apt或yum)来安装这些服务器。
3.1 安装Apache
sudo apt update sudo apt install apache2
3.2 安装Nginx
sudo apt update sudo apt install nginx
4. 配置Web服务器
根据你的需求配置Web服务器,这可能包括更改默认的网站根目录、配置虚拟主机等。
5. 上传网站文件
使用FTP客户端(如FileZilla)或SCP命令将你的网站文件上传到云主机。
6. 测试网站
在浏览器中输入你的云主机的IP地址或域名,看看网站是否正常运行。
7. 配置域名解析
如果你有自己的域名,你需要将其解析到你的云主机的IP地址,这通常在你的域名注册商的控制面板中完成。
8. 安装数据库(如果需要)
如果你的网站需要数据库(如MySQL或PostgreSQL),你需要在云主机上安装并配置它。
9. 安装其他必要的软件
根据你的网站的需求,你可能还需要安装其他软件,如PHP、Python、Node.js等。
10. 安全设置
不要忘记进行一些基本的安全设置,如更新系统和软件、配置防火墙规则、禁用root登录等。
以上就是在云主机上部署网站的基本步骤,具体的操作可能会根据你的云主机提供商和你的网站的具体需求有所不同。
本站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本站,有问题联系侵删!
本文链接:http://www.xixizhuji.com/fuzhu/134603.html